Definitions and Meaning of incautious in English

incautious adjective

  1. carelessly failing to exercise proper caution

    Example

    • "an incautious step sent her headlong down the stairs"
  2. lacking in caution

    Examples

    • "an incautious remark"
    • "incautious talk"

Antonyms of incautious

cautious
